Me Myself And I
Alone and yet together
through what's been and yet to be.
Me myself and I
my hopes and dreams and me.
That part of me the dreamer
somehow he helps me cope.
My dreams of tomorrow
together with my hope.
Still sometimes they go too far
and I can clearly see.
The dreams sometimes I hope for
that are not meant to be.
Nights alone not long ago
I trembled while I cried.
As all my hopes were shattered
I watched as my dreams died.
Left with me myself and I
just like it's been forever.
I whispered to the hope in me
Come. Lets dream together.
Picking up the broken pieces
casting out my fear and sorrow.
All my hopes and dreams and me
we turned to face tomorrow.
And on and on and on we go
through tears we sometimes cry.
All my hopes and dreams and me
and me myself and I.
Edwin C Hofert
